1 / 6

CNY 1778.16

CNY 3175.28 44%

Android 15 For Land Rover Discovery 4 LR4 Spotr 2009-2017 Original Style Car Radio Multimedia Player Carplay Android Auto Screen

More To Love
View details & Buy